According to tech wizard Leo Notenboom, “a new twist” on hackers comprising Hotmail accounts has left some users with unauthorized (and poorly written) ads in all of their outgoing messages. Notenboom explains that the culprit is a default email signature created by the hacker. Learn how to change your Hotmail email signature in his article: [...]

In early July, a hacker comprised the email account of a Twitter employee, and stole some internal company documents. He did this by using the password reminder feature of Gmail. What can we learn from this? First, use unique, unusual passwords. Second, make sure the answers to your security questions are not easily guessed. Third, [...]
